1 DISCUSSION QUESTIONS: Ephesians 5:22-6:9 1) How does Ephesians 5:21 relate to each of the specific roles Paul mentions in 5:22-6:9? 2) Why do you think Paul chose to express servanthood differently in some of the six human relationships he addresses? 3) Why do you think Paul directs slaves to obey their masters, or even for wives to submit to their husbands for that matter? Do you think that the Bible advocates slavery or abusive relationships? Support your opinion with scripture if possible. 4) Why do you think Paul illustrates appropriate human relationships with Christ s relationship with the church? What parallels do you see? 5) Do you think adult children need to honor their parents? Why? 6) In what relationships are you currently experiencing conflict? How has the study of Ephesians 5:21-6:9 affected your perspective on how to deal with those disputes? 7) Do you think the Bible teaches that we should always submit to others? When do you think a person should not submit? 8) What is the most important thing you ve discovered in the series on Ephesians so far? Spend time praying for those who are currently experiencing conflict in their relationships.

WIVES 22 Wives, submit to your (own) husbands as to the Lord. Submit: hupotasso. The same word used in 5:21 for everyone. Some read, husbands, command your wives. (not) To your own husband (NASB) Limits this specific submission to her own husband. (husband is HER personal possession) Verbal ju-jitsu? Although countercultural, great deal of misunderstanding.
4 Subscript 23 For the husband is the head of the wife as Christ is the head of the church, his body, of which he is the Savior. 24 Now as the church submits to Christ, so also wives should submit to their husbands in everything. John MacArthur study Bible notes: The Spirit-filled wife recognizes that her husband s role in giving leadership is not only God-ordained, but is a reflection of Christ s own loving, authoritative headship of the church. Just as the Lord delivered His church from the dangers of sin, death, and hell, so the husband provides for, protects, preserves, and loves his wife, leading her to blessing as she submits. What does submission to Jesus look like? There is a line of authority in the home, the buck stops here. A good leader can follow. We follow Christ because we trust him, because he loves us. It is the same for wives. Sometimes, our submission is because of a greater good, (out of reverence for Christ). CHILDREN 6:1 Children, obey your parents in the Lord, for this is right. 2 Honor your father and mother --which is the first commandment with a promise-- 3 that it may go well with you and that you may enjoy long life on the earth. 1. Obey: listen or attend to. Doing what you re told, when you re told, with the right attitude. 2. Honor: Place value on Subscript 3 that it may go well with you and that you may enjoy long life on the earth. (Deuteronomy 4:40) Protective umbrella of parental authority Parents, how do you read this? What if the shoe were on the other foot?
6 4. PARENTS 4 Fathers, do not exasperate your children; instead, bring them up in the training and instruction of the Lord. Exasperate: parogizo, provoke to anger. (embarrass?) The harshness of fatherhood of biblical times Instead indicates juxtaposition. Bring them up: ektrepho; to nourish or bring to maturity 5. EMPLOYEES 5 Slaves, obey your earthly masters Slaves: doulos, bond slave, by conscious choice. Closest application is employeremployee relationship. Obey: place under authority Subscript with respect and fear, and with sincerity of heart, just as you would obey Christ. 6 Obey them not only to win their favor when their eye is on you, but like slaves of Christ, doing the will of God from your heart. 7 Serve wholeheartedly, as if you were serving the Lord, not men, 8 because you know that the Lord will reward everyone for whatever good he does, whether he is slave or free. Applies to any supervisor The Bible does not specifically endorse slavery, but does condemn the abuse of others, and clearly establishes the dignity of human beings, regardless of color, gender etc. God is not a respecter of persons How complicated interaction must have been in the early church How do you suppose this teaching struck them?
